Scores 8 out of 100, poor for a GP surgery in England. 58% of patients say their experience is good and 40% find it easy to get through on the phone (England: 77% and 57%). Inspectors rated it Good in 2018. It is taking on new patients.

Poor Scores higher than 8% of GP surgeries in England. 16th of 18 in Blackburn Based on 96 patient survey replies, the inspection rating and NHS records.

Common questions

Is Family Practice taking on new patients?

Yes. When we last checked its page on the NHS website (20 September 2026), Family Practice was taking on new patients. You can register online through the NHS website or call the surgery on 01254 360123.

How do patients rate Family Practice?

In the 2026 NHS GP Patient Survey, 58% of patients at Family Practice said their overall experience was good. The England average is 77%. 40% found it easy to get through by phone (England 57%). Its GPScore is 8 out of 100, grade E, which puts it in the bottom 20% of GP surgeries in England.

What is the inspection rating for Family Practice?

The Care Quality Commission, which inspects GP surgeries in England, rated Family Practice as Good at its last published inspection (report published 26 November 2018).

What are the opening times of Family Practice?

Reception is open Monday 8am to 6:30pm, Tuesday 8am to 7:30pm, Wednesday 8am to 6:30pm, Thursday 8am to 6:30pm, Friday 8am to 6:30pm, Saturday closed, Sunday closed. The surgery last confirmed these times on 25 November 2024. Bank holidays may differ.

How do I contact Family Practice?

Call 01254 360123 or visit its website, thefamilypracticeblackburn.com. You can also book and order repeat prescriptions in the NHS App. The address is Barbara Castle Way Health Centre, Simmons Street, Blackburn, BB2 1AX.

How many patients are registered at Family Practice?

Around 5,391 patients are registered (January 2025). The surgery is part of Blackburn West PCN, a group of local surgeries that share staff and services, in the Lancashire and South Cumbria NHS area.
